[Pkg-gnupg-maint] Bug#761026: Bug#761026: gpa: GPGME Error at keytable.c:150 'Unsupported certificate' renders GPA unusable

NIIBE Yutaka gniibe at fsij.org
Wed Sep 10 05:22:25 UTC 2014


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

On 09/10/2014 01:58 PM, Daniel Dickinson wrote:
> On 09/09/14 11:23 PM, NIIBE Yutaka wrote:
>> On 2014-09-09 at 23:09 -0400, Daniel Dickinson wrote:
>>> The GPME library returned an unexpected error at
>>> keytable.c:150.  The was: Unsupported certificate
>> 
>> I think that it is GNOME keyring which gets the connection to 
>> gpg-agent (and produced the error).
[...]
> You are in fact correct, with the caveat I am using XFCE and had
> the XFCE startup option (Start GNOME Services) enabled which
> automatically runs gnome-keyring with all options (including gpg
> agent) and there doesn't seem to be a way to deselect that unless
> you turn off that option and only select the gnome-keyring services
> you specifically want (in my case gnome-keyring, for
> network-manager).
> 
> Perhaps the error message could be improved to suggest such an 
> issue/solution so that users know where to look.
> 
> Especially given the error message that is thrown it didn't occur
> to me that it was not a bug or other packaging error (since the
> error claims it is).

Thank you for your bug report and your opinion.  The cause is GNOME
keyring, but, I agree that it's a kind of bug of GnuPG and friends
from users' point of view.

For years, I have been struggling to disable this "feature" of GNOME
Keyring.

Last month, I wrote to its maintainer (when asked):

    http://lists.gnupg.org/pipermail/gnupg-devel/2014-August/028691.html

In the message, I only addressed about smartcard/token and SSH.

Your bug report is another important case.
- -- 
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.12 (GNU/Linux)
Comment: Using GnuPG with Icedove - http://www.enigmail.net/

iQEcBAEBCAAGBQJUD+APAAoJEAC0Xr1Mp7q+racH/iu/3ELtWZJ8inzT3BiiCQRj
Bu5ZFhl6mn7Wf/K0TRpvap3QfEEhi4eQxWnOPHtjAnvU2qlrbtDE4hkxicwrI8Av
r8055JTwnUIOwFszaAwQlUfSG375hfRMvIWAUXe0IYR2PWlIZuNeuNJVbdgj7uvj
DiopnXenHpY2SkdZrLB7U3biJMDIxk+pOWFIgSo+6qhH95Vd/lOC4HSmdJmYESw2
BW4WsOCKXB1LGaT3iKm7ftGv1XxRc+5hzgY1N252v+wkXZnSg9QXX4UJC2EnDFRi
rYWMzUDVofBOTLZVidP69NQ5q9q4ZN6vHxBZs2RYs4j23CBStoFENrooHUhQbD0=
=mWrD
-----END PGP SIGNATURE-----



More information about the Pkg-gnupg-maint mailing list